  Created by: Genndy Tartakovsky Produced by: Sam Register, Genndy Tartakovsky, Shareena Carlson Starring: Hazel Doupe (Emma/Melinda), Demari Hunte (Alfie/Edred), Tom Milligan (Dimitri/Seng) Unicorn: Warriors Eternal Season 1 trailer : This show is pretty ridiculous, but in a great, often intellectual way.  It's got a lot going on, a bit too much for its own good. I'll be the first to admit that. To put it succinctly, the show is about a group of warriors who live and exist throughout time, reincarnating in different eras to fight a major evil that keeps cropping up. Oh, and the group is called "Unicorn." The group has four members: Melinda is a powerful sorceress, Edred is an elf swordsman, Seng is a psychic, and Copernicus is a sentient robot who can manipulate souls.  Copernicus, Melinda, and Edred ready for battle The show's weakness is that it throws all this out a little too fast, not really giving the viewer enough chance to absorb it and breath...
